Betty White's Publicist: The Coronavirus Is Afraid of the Golden Girls Icon
AceShowbiz
Celebrity

The 98-year-old actress is said to be staying safe and keeping her sense of humor amid the pandemic, while enjoying daily visit from a number of wild animals in her beautiful backyard.

AceShowbiz - Betty White remains in good health. As the country continues to fight against the coronavirus pandemic, an update has come from "The Golden Girls" icon's camp. A publicist for the 98-year-old actress assured that the funnywoman is "doing very well" in quarantine, joking that "the virus is afraid" of her.

In an email statement to Today, the representative revealed how the actress playing Elka Ostrovsky on "Hot in Cleveland" protected herself and stayed safe during the global crisis. "No one permitted in except those who must," her rep explained, before adding that she "has helpers who are great with her."

White's publicist additionally noted that despite having to stay at home, "The Lost Valentine" actress did not lose her sense of humor. "We always have laughs," the rep stated.

As for her day-to-day activity, White was said to be enjoying the accompaniment of the wildlife in her backyard. "Betty has beautiful backyard with a number of wild animals visiting. Two ducks always come by to say hello. They waddle up to her glass door and look in," her rep shared. "The animal community is watching over her."

Days earlier, White herself told Closer Weekly that she is "blessed with incredibly good health." She added, "That's something you appreciate a lot." Her entertainer friend Tom Sullivan additionally revealed that she spent her time in self-isolation reading the Los Angeles Times "cover to cover."

"She owns literally thousands of crossword puzzle books and is constantly doing them to keep her mind jumping," he added. "This is really serious with her." Another close friend, in the meantime, claimed that she has "tried Zooming her Scrabble game with her friends, but it's not quite the same."

On the actress' fondness of vodka martini, her friend explained to the magazine, "Betty loves to joke that vodka keeps her young. She loves the image of her sitting at home in a rocking chair, drinking a martini and watching game shows, but she's not really a big drinker. That's not her. She'll only take a few sips of a cocktail if the occasion calls for it."
